The cheapest way to get from Carles to Bacolod City is to drive and ferry via Silay City which costs ₱950 - ₱1,600 and takes 3h 48m.
The fastest way to get from Carles to Bacolod City is to drive and ferry which takes 3h 13m and costs ₱1,000 - ₱1,500.
The distance between Carles and Bacolod City is 124 km.
The best way to get from Carles to Bacolod City without a car is to taxi and ferry which takes 3h 18m and costs ₱2,500 - ₱3,500.
It takes approximately 3h 48m to get from Carles to Bacolod City,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Carles to Bacolod City. However, you can drive to Ajuy, take the ferry to EB Magalona, drive to Silay City, then take the bus to Bacolod.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Carles to Bacolod City via Ajuy and EB Magalona in around 3h 13m.
